ПОМОГИТЕ, ГУРУ и СПЕЦЫ!

Проблемы с установкой или работой phpBB 2.0.x? Ищите ответы здесь!
Аватара пользователя
Castro
phpBB 1.4.0
Сообщения: 32
Стаж: 19 лет 9 месяцев

ПОМОГИТЕ, ГУРУ и СПЕЦЫ!

Сообщение Castro »

Господа, простите, если не нашёл по дурости.
Есть три вопроса.
(Дайте, плз, ссылки, если уже есть на форуме это).
Первое:
Где ковырнуть, и где вставить, и какой <br/> или break, чтобы строка ломалась после времени, перед именем юзера на главной странице форума, а не так, как у меня:
Изображение
ВТОРОЕ: как сделать так, чтобы неавторизованный юзер (гость) не мог просматривать юзер лист? Это возможно? (В модах не нашёл).
Третье: есть ли мод для показа окна (типа как небольшая table на главной, в header), которое бы исчезала, как только юзер залогинился? (Нашёл popup, но это некрасиво, мне не нравится).
За подробные ответы для "чайника" челом бью!!!
Ибо боюсь очень что-то поломать в отлаженном механизмусе... :oops:
Аватара пользователя
Vladson
Former team member
Сообщения: 816
Стаж: 21 год
Откуда: Estonia, Tallinn

Сообщение Vladson »

Основное: прочитайте правила (пункт 2.2 и пункт 4.4) и сделайте выводы (относительно названия темы)

Первое: посмотрите в index.php, если не найдёте то приходите ещё.

Второе: Да у нас нет в базе этого мода, но изготовление его настолько просто что скорее всего он есть на www.phpbb.com/

Третье: Ну смотря что за окно нужно, возможно вам в Запросы.
Серый цвет - светлый (светлее чёрного), но он и тёмный (темнее белого), он же промежуточный (между чёрным и белым). Теорию относительности никто не отменял. Истина в целом - понятие виртуально-ситуативное.
sigal
phpBB Plus
Сообщения: 442
Стаж: 20 лет 11 месяцев
Откуда: КПРФ ;)

Сообщение sigal »

по поводу второго:

Код: Выделить всё

#
#-----[ OPEN ]------------------------------------------
#

memberlist.php

#
#-----[ FIND ]------------------------------------------
#
 
//
// End session management
//

#
#-----[ AFTER, ADD ]------------------------------------
# 

if ( !$userdata['session_logged_in'] )
	{
		redirect(append_sid("login.".$phpEx."?redirect=memberlist.".$phpEx, true));
		exit;
	}
по поводу третьего: бери код объекта в :

Код: Выделить всё

<!-- BEGIN switch_user_logged_out --> 

<!-- END switch_user_logged_out -->
Аватара пользователя
Siava
Поддержка
Поддержка
Сообщения: 5432
Стаж: 20 лет 4 месяца
Откуда: Питер
Благодарил (а): 177 раз
Поблагодарили: 749 раз

Сообщение Siava »

sigal
sigal писал(а):по поводу третьего: бери код объекта в :
Скорее уж в

Код: Выделить всё

<!-- BEGIN switch_user_logged_in -->

<!-- END switch_user_logged_in --> 
:lol:

1. в index.php найди и вставь перенос куда надо =)

Код: Выделить всё

                                                                $last_post .= '<a href="' . append_sid("viewtopic.$phpEx?"  . POST_POST_URL . '=' . $forum_data[$j]['forum_last_post_id']) . '#' . $forum_data[$j]['forum_last_post_id'] . '"><img src="' . $images['icon_latest_reply'] . '" border="0" alt="' . $lang['View_latest_post'] . '" title="' . $lang['View_latest_post'] . '" /></a>';
Еще одно нарушение правил и будете забанены. © Mr. Anderson
Ты очистил кеш? © Sheer
https://siava.ru (phpbb 2.0.x 3.5.x)
Xpert
phpBB Guru
phpBB Guru
Сообщения: 5484
Стаж: 21 год 2 месяца
Поблагодарили: 2 раза

Сообщение Xpert »

Siava писал(а):Скорее уж в
Там же написано: пока юзер - гость. Так что правилен вариант sigal
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
Аватара пользователя
Castro
phpBB 1.4.0
Сообщения: 32
Стаж: 19 лет 9 месяцев

Сообщение Castro »

Огромное спасибо за второе и третье!
Всё сделал.
Но вот что надо сделать для перенося строки, не пойму... :oops:
Код у меня точно такой же:

Код: Выделить всё

$last_post .= '<a href="' . append_sid("viewtopic.$phpEx?"  . POST_POST_URL . '=' . $forum_data[$j]['forum_last_post_id']) . '#' . $forum_data[$j]['forum_last_post_id'] . '"><img src="' . $images['icon_latest_reply'] . '" border="0" alt="' . $lang['View_latest_post'] . '" title="' . $lang['View_latest_post'] . '" /></a>';
- но переноса нет...
Аватара пользователя
VVVas
Former team member
Сообщения: 4463
Стаж: 20 лет 6 месяцев
Поблагодарили: 1 раз

Сообщение VVVas »

Castro
Потому что это не весь код построения. Смотрите внимательней выше и ниже приведенного фрагмента и работайте со всеми.
я люблю daft punk | новый sugoi.ru
Аватара пользователя
Castro
phpBB 1.4.0
Сообщения: 32
Стаж: 19 лет 9 месяцев

Сообщение Castro »

Что-то я неправильно разрыв строки вставляю... :oops:
Всё время пишет: Parse error: parse error, unexpected '>' in /phpbb/index.php on line 637
Аватара пользователя
svk
phpBB 2.0.3
Сообщения: 384
Стаж: 19 лет 10 месяцев
Откуда: Москва, Fortuna-net

Сообщение svk »

символ ">" надо экранировать

Добавлено спустя 33 секунды:

Да и разрыв строки можно не <br> или <p> делать, а символом \n
NETBYNET Holding system administrator

Вернуться в «Поддержка phpBB 2.0.x»